
RJ Kelly (RJK) announced that btone FITNESS Charlestown has officially opened at 40 Warren St. in Charlestown. The new 1,500 square-foot studio is the growing brand’s latest franchise to open and joins several other Greater Boston locations including those in Back Bay, the North End, South Boston, Dorchester and Somerville. A new Brighton studio is slated to open early this summer.
“Charlestown is a neighborhood that takes pride in supporting businesses with local roots, and btone FITNESS fits that spirit perfectly,” said RJK CEO Brandon Kelly. “As a Massachusetts-founded brand with a loyal following across Greater Boston, btone brings a wellness amenity that further solidifies 40 Warren’s position at the centerpiece of Charlestown’s live-work culture.”
JLL’s Bryan Sparkes and Brian Flaherty handle leasing for the building. Dodge Tucker of Tucker Real Estate represented btone FITNESS. The brand was founded in 2010 by Cape Cod native Jody Merrill and now extends to numerous locations throughout New England as well as Florida, Illinois, North Carolina and Utah.
